Welcome to the Payments pod at Brindlework. Every retry of a charge request must reuse the original idempotency key, generated client-side and stored with the order. Never mint a new key on retry — that's how duplicate charges happen. Keys expire after 24 hours. To access the retry dashboard's admin mode, you'll need the team recovery passphrase, which is:

unlock words, hahip-baduf: holwyn-istath-julvan

Management Meeting Minutes — Tollery Licensing Dispute

Present: dept heads plus Marek from Legal.

Quick recap: Tollery Systems claims our Windrush module breaches their patent on the scheduling engine. Marek thinks their position is shaky but slow to fight. We agreed to keep negotiating while prepping a workaround build — Engineering says six weeks, maybe eight. No public comments from anyone, please. Next check-in is in a fortnight. One more item was noted for restricted circulation below.

internal memo for kaduf-baduf: Only 35 of the 378 pilot accounts renewed Holir, so a churn review is set for June 11. Eliielax Group is in early talks to buy Silaelix Group for about $142.1 million.

### Parcelwire Webhook Release

Rotate the webhook signing material before each quarterly release. Verify HMAC validation is enforced on all inbound tracking events — reject unsigned payloads, no grace window. Confirm replay protection (5-minute timestamp skew) is active in the Dunmere staging stack. Once checks pass, deploy with the standard pipeline. The signing key for this release follows below.

deploy key for kajof-fajop: bky6_gDHw9Q